I did some more testing (everything under 2.2.5):

* created a primary partition (full size) with fdisk -b 2048 /dev/sdc
(fdisk 2.9i - fdisk 2.9g created a buggy one)
* formatted the partition with mke2fs -b 2048 -m 0 -L test /dev/sdc1
(mke2fs 1.14)
* mounted the partition (as user, with mount 2.9i)
* copied my quake2 dir to it
* umounted it
* rebooted
* ran "e2fsck -B 2048 -f -n /dev/sdc1 >/tmp/01" (write-protected disk,
e2fsck 1.14). /tmp/01 is 315194 bytes. Tons of errors

Please don't tell me this is a feature.
